(A-loh-jeh-NAY-ik stem sel tranz-plan-TAY-shun)
![](https://webarchive.library.unt.edu/eot2008/20090116012516im_/http://www.cancer.gov/images/spacer.gif)
| A procedure in which a person receives blood-forming stem cells (cells from which all blood cells develop) from a genetically similar, but not identical, donor. This is often a sister or brother, but could be an unrelated donor. |
